public WordprocessingMLPackage export(String xhtml) { WordprocessingMLPackage wordMLPackage = null; try { RFonts arialRFonts = Context.getWmlObjectFactory().createRFonts(); arialRFonts.setAscii("Arial"); arialRFonts.setHAnsi("Arial"); XHTMLImporterImpl.addFontMapping("Arial", arialRFonts); wordMLPackage = WordprocessingMLPackage.createPackage(); XHTMLImporter importer = new XHTMLImporterImpl(wordMLPackage); List<Object> content = importer.convert(xhtml,null); wordMLPackage.getMainDocumentPart().getContent().addAll(content); } catch (Docx4JException e) { // ... } return wordMLPackage; }
